Python 프로그래밍 분야 최고의 취업 동향 분석
소개:
최근 몇 년간 Python 프로그래밍 언어의 인기가 급격하게 높아졌으며 다양한 분야에서 적용 사례도 점차 늘어나고 있습니다. 디지털 시대에 Python 프로그래밍 기술을 갖추는 것은 이상적인 취업 기회를 찾는 핵심 요소 중 하나가 되었습니다. 이 기사에서는 Python 프로그래밍의 주요 직업 동향을 살펴보고 관련 코드 예제를 제공합니다. 초보자이건 경험이 풍부한 개발자이건 여기에서 귀중한 정보를 얻을 수 있습니다.
import numpy as np import pandas as pd from sklearn.model_selection import train_test_split from sklearn.linear_model import LinearRegression # 读取数据集 data = pd.read_csv('data.csv') # 数据预处理 X = data[['feature1', 'feature2', 'feature3']] y = data['target'] X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.2, random_state=42) # 模型训练和预测 model = LinearRegression() model.fit(X_train, y_train) y_pred = model.predict(X_test) # 模型评估 score = model.score(X_test, y_test)
위 코드는 Python의 Pandas 라이브러리를 사용하여 데이터를 읽고 처리하고 Scikit-learn 라이브러리의 선형 회귀 모델을 사용하여 학습하는 방법을 보여줍니다. 예측하고, 모델 평가 지표를 사용하여 모델 성능을 평가합니다.
import requests from bs4 import BeautifulSoup import pandas as pd # 发送HTTP请求获取网页内容 response = requests.get('https://example.com') html = response.text # 使用BeautifulSoup解析网页 soup = BeautifulSoup(html, 'html.parser') # 提取所需数据 data = [] for item in soup.find_all('div', class_='item'): title = item.find('h2').text price = item.find('span', class_='price').text data.append({'title': title, 'price': price}) # 将数据转换为DataFrame对象 df = pd.DataFrame(data) # 数据分析和可视化 mean_price = df['price'].mean() max_price = df['price'].max()
위 코드는 Python의 요청 라이브러리를 사용하여 HTTP 요청을 보내 웹 페이지 콘텐츠를 얻고 BeautifulSoup 라이브러리를 사용하여 구문 분석하는 방법을 보여줍니다. HTML 콘텐츠. 그런 다음 구문 분석된 웹 페이지에서 필요한 데이터를 추출하고 Pandas 라이브러리를 사용하여 데이터를 DataFrame 개체로 변환합니다. 마지막으로 데이터를 분석하고 시각화할 수 있습니다.
from flask import Flask, render_template app = Flask(__name__) @app.route('/') def index(): return render_template('index.html') @app.route('/about') def about(): return render_template('about.html') if __name__ == '__main__': app.run(debug=True)
위 코드는 Flask 라이브러리를 사용하여 간단한 웹사이트를 만들고 다양한 경로에서 다양한 HTML 템플릿을 렌더링하는 방법을 보여줍니다. 코드를 실행하면 로컬에서 웹사이트를 시작하고 해당 URL을 방문하여 다른 페이지를 볼 수 있습니다.
요약:
Python 프로그래밍 분야의 취업 전망은 매우 광범위합니다. 이 기사에서는 데이터 과학 및 기계 학습, 웹 스크래핑 및 데이터 분석, 웹 개발 및 자동화의 예를 제시합니다. 이러한 예는 다양한 분야에서 Python을 적용한 빙산의 일각에 불과합니다. 초보자이든 숙련된 개발자이든 이상적인 Python 프로그래밍 직업을 찾을 수 있는 기회가 있습니다. 계속해서 기술을 배우고 향상시키는 한 Python 프로그래밍의 최신 동향을 따라가고 기회가 가득한 이 업계에서 성공할 수 있습니다.
위 내용은 Python 프로그래밍 분야 최고의 직업 동향 분석의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!